Output 23db3316d8e73602a8ee4e2f221d885736c3b17c7c6a5fc465f6621a2525b3df:0

value
31517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73678b5ef64cbe7f9e5cbc55e2bd819530f11c36 OP_EQUAL
address
3CDDfzkZShd3pZ1oedswvEteQ256KAc3jQ
transaction
23db3316d8e73602a8ee4e2f221d885736c3b17c7c6a5fc465f6621a2525b3df
spent
true